Miles between Deerfield Beach, FL and Prichard, AL

There are
688 mi
from Deerfield Beach, FL to Prichard, AL

That's the driving distance. It would take 12 hours 28 mins to go from Deerfield Beach, Florida to Prichard, Alabama.

The flight distance (direct flight from Deerfield Beach, FL to Prichard, AL) is 572.35 mi.

688 mi = 1,106.92 kms